Getting into Kayaking

Many people want to get into and learn about kayaking without knowing specifically what type or even where they will go. These are two important questions to have answered as they will have an impact on the type of kayaking gear a person will buy. Some of the many types of kayaking are whitewater kayaking, sea kayaking, touring, recreational kayaking, sit-on-top kayaking, kayak fishing, and kayak camping to name a few. Each of these genres require different gear and have different skill requirements. It is therefore important to know which you want to get into. All About Kayaking Gear

Having settled on the type of kayaking you’ll be doing, the next thing to do is to purchase some kayaking gear. You don’t want to just walk into a big box sporting goods store and buy the first kayak you see. Sit-on-top kayaks are different from whitewater kayaks. Sea kayaks are different from recreational kayaks. Doing your research to know what type of boat, paddle, and gear you want will help save you the aggravation of making a costly mistake when it comes to gear purchase.
